As we look to the days ahead, it will be with the desire to honor our Lord Jesus. Paul paused in the midst of his letter to the Romans and offered one of the great doxologies of Scripture.

"For from Him, and through Him, and to Him are all things. To Him be glory forever!" Romans 11:36

Friends, there is nothing of worth in our lives that has not come from our Lord Jesus. He is the source of all things. All things are "from Him".

And all things are "through Him". There is nothing in life that comes to us that is not through Him. Colossians tells us that all things are held together by the Lord. And if He ever stops holding it together, it will fly apart. It is through Him we are reconciled to the Father. All things are "through Him".

And all things are "to Him". The end of all things is the glory of God. Why did Jesus come? For the glory of God. Why did Jesus die? For the glory of God. Why are you and I born? For the glory of God. Why does the church exist? For the glory of God. Why does Heart of Kansas Southern Baptist Association exist? It is not for you or me. All things are "to Him". We exist as individuals and as churches and as an association for the glory of God. All things are unto Him.

Since all things are from Him, and all things are through Him, and all things are to Him, we can therefore understand that all glory is His. "To Him be glory forever!"
